• There's A Treasure Chest Containing Over $10K Buried Somewhere In San Francisco (patch.com) — San Franciscans are invited to join a new citywide treasure hunt, with a 150-pound chest containing $10,001 buried somewhere under a foot of soil within city limits. Anonymous organizers, who launched the game on the r/sanfrancisco subreddit, have released a dense riddle of clues and say one searcher has already come very close. Participants need no special equipment, just patience, puzzle skills, and a willingness to explore San Francisco’s parks and viewpoints.    

• San Francisco woman gets photographer's old phone number: it changes both their lives (nbcbayarea.com) — A San Francisco-connected photographer’s legacy is getting new life after a local woman was accidentally assigned his old phone number and started receiving messages meant for him. Their unlikely friendship has led to a GoFundMe, new social media accounts, and fresh attention on his iconic Bay Area images, including a famous Loma Prieta earthquake shot of the Bay Bridge.    

• SF immigration court — one of the busiest in the nation — closes months ahead of schedule (sfstandard.com) — San Francisco’s main immigration court at 100 Montgomery St. has permanently closed months early, shifting nearly 120,000 cases to the already overburdened Concord court. With local judges cut from 22 to just two, asylum seekers and immigrants from across Northern California now face even longer waits and more complicated logistics for hearings in and around the city.
